Emil Eriksen biography, is a Norwegian television personality, adventurer, and public figure best known for his appearances in documentary and reality TV programs that highlight life in extreme environments. He gained international recognition through the Discovery Channel series “Out of the Wild: The Alaska Experiment” and later through the popular Norwegian documentary series “71° North.” His rugged lifestyle, survival skills, and charismatic screen presence have made him a respected name in adventure television.

Breakthrough: “Out of the Wild: The Alaska Experiment”
Emil Eriksen gained global recognition through Discovery Channel’s survival reality show:
Show Concept
Participants were left in the Alaskan wilderness and had to survive extreme conditions using limited resources.

“71° North” Fame
Emil further rose to prominence through Norway’s hit adventure documentary series:
About the Show
“71° North” follows participants traveling across Norway’s harsh terrain — from south to the Arctic north — completing survival challenges.
